IRVING, TX — Professional services firm Thomas Group has named James “Jim” Taylor CEO and president of the company, effective Jan. 13.

Taylor succeeds John Hamann as CEO. For the last three years, Taylor has served as Thomas Group’s executive vice president and CFO. He has been credited for successfully returning Thomas Group to profitability following the 2001 consulting industry downturn and global recession. Taylor will remain CFO on an interim basis while assuming his new responsibilities.

Taylor has spent more than 30 years in the consulting industry and in operations management. He began his career at Coopers and Lybrand and while partner there, led the southwest region’s mergers and acquisitions group. He owned and led seven other companies, including his own start-up businesses.
